Career path

Career Role Description
IIoT Security Engineer (Plastics) Develops and implements robust cybersecurity solutions for IIoT devices and networks within plastics manufacturing, focusing on data integrity and protection against threats. Requires expertise in industrial protocols and network security.
Industrial Cybersecurity Analyst (Plastics) Monitors and analyzes IIoT network traffic for suspicious activity within plastics factories. Responds to security incidents, performs vulnerability assessments, and ensures compliance with industry regulations. Deep understanding of threat intelligence crucial.
IIoT Security Consultant (Plastics) Provides expert advice on IIoT security best practices to plastics companies. Conducts security audits, develops security strategies, and assists with implementation of security controls. Strong communication and client management skills needed.
Data Security Specialist (Plastics Manufacturing) Focuses on protecting sensitive data generated by IIoT systems in plastics manufacturing, including implementing data loss prevention measures and ensuring compliance with data privacy regulations. Strong knowledge of data governance essential.
